Output e18629674ca769c751e551079cfa341271f1bfcc25c0371d70bc4b52a6a7b910:0

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f57169b1f743b1dd6541a485dc3b44e00fcb3843 OP_EQUAL
address
3Q4oLc99JxTyYaBbkgmtX4sEEu3uH9A737
transaction
e18629674ca769c751e551079cfa341271f1bfcc25c0371d70bc4b52a6a7b910
confirmations
504087
spent
true